I started out by printing a sheet of paper from the BRIGHT Butterflies Additions digital collection and used a PTI Mat Stack die to die cut the shape. I then used a PTI Butterfly die to die cut the butterfly shape. I stamped the 'Hello' sentiment from Time and added some linen thread and a button.

For my next card I decided to use the supplies I had out and left from my first card & came up with this card...



I used the same LO but used the die cut butterfly from the first card! Great way to use supplies already out on your desk.

I'm back today however with the next instalment in the previously released product focus and my focus today is Background Builders Lattice...




This is a FAB building set which uses the trendy lattice/quatrefoil image - yum! So how about a few NEW projects using this set...




Keeping it Clean & Simple for this minty fresh beauty for the Moxie FAB World Minty Fresh Challenge HERE and also the Addicted To Stamps CAS Challenge HERE

I started out by masking off 2cm at the top and bottom of the card base I stamped one of the Background Builder Lattice stamps in Fresh Snow ink. I then took a piece of white card stock stamped and embossed another of the Lattice designs using fine detail white embossing powder. I then used one Distress Marker colour to create a monochrome ombre effect on the 2 layer butterfly. 

Here's a close up ...




Background Builders Lattice also has a digital downloadable paper collection called Modern Lattice available HERE and seen below...




I had to use my FAVE paper from this collection for my next card, the tiny floral paper and kept it CAS to keep in line with the Addicted To Stamps CAS Challenge...




I selected some Soft Stone card stock to use as a mat for the patterned paper before adhering it to the white card base. I left a gap to break up the patterned paper collection and to create space for a sentiment from Time. The die cut flower is a Memory Box die and die cut from card stock which coordinates with the collection.
